Lakshadweep's tourism grows with new proposals for development

Lakshadweep is a group of 36 islands, ten of which are inhabited. The government has lately suggested developing more tourism initiatives there. The famous Paradise Island huts are among the government-run tourism attractions overseen by SPORTS (Society for Promotion of Nature Tourism and Sports). A new plan pertaining to the Smart City programme seeks to establish a hotel with ninety rooms. This surge in the tourism development signals an exciting phase for Lakshadweep's travel landscape.
